Bible Cross References
Come, eat of my bread, and drink of the wine which I have mingled.
Proverbs 9:2
She has slaughtered her meat, She has mixed her wine, She has also furnished her table.
Proverbs 9:17
"Stolen water is sweet, And bread [eaten] in secret is pleasant."
Psalm 22:26
The poor shall eat and be satisfied; Those who seek Him will praise the LORD. Let your heart live forever!
Psalm 22:29
All the prosperous of the earth Shall eat and worship; All those who go down to the dust Shall bow before Him, Even he who cannot keep himself alive.
Song of Songs 5:1
I have come to my garden, my sister, [my] spouse; I have gathered my myrrh with my spice; I have eaten my honeycomb with my honey; I have drunk my wine with my milk. (TO HIS FRIENDS) Eat, O friends! Drink, yes, drink deeply, O beloved ones! THE SHULAMITE
